Question 68 2 pts On January 1, the shop owner withdrew P100,000 from her personal savings account and invested it in the shop. The next day, the owner bought shop equipment amounting to P10,000 in cash. On January 15, the business paid the January rent amounting to P30,000. In the shop's books, how much is the Cash balance as of month-end? P60,000 O P50,000 OP90,000 O P80,000 Question 67 2 pts You were given the following selected account balances of a service firm as of year-end: Salaries and Wages Expense: P320,000 Rent Expense: P50,000 Accrued Interest Expense: P2,000 Utilities Expense: P85,000 Prepaid Insurance Expense: P70,000 . . Based solely on the above, how much was the company's total expenses for the year? O P527,000 P457,000 P525,000 P455,000
